TRAVEL

Ohio Glaciers 13U — won the Mid May Classic at Kent State. They went 4-0 and outscored opponents 44-3. Ohio Glaciers defeated Pittsburgh Diamond Dogs 11-2 in the championship game. Members of the team include Joe DeLucia (Canfield), Lucas Nasonti (Champion), Joey Machuga (Canfield), Michael McDonough (Columbiana), Zack Tinkey (Canfield), Michael Turner (Champion) and Anthony Vross (Canfield).

WRESTLING

Vince Mancini, Nick Mancini and Joe Cordova represented Green Machine Wrestling Club at the FILA Cadet Nationals in Akron. Vince Mancini competed in 86-92.5 pounds; Nick Mancini in 127.75 pounds and Cordova in 187.25 pounds. Each boy was defeated in two matches.
